Items Necessary for "Church"

Contrary to popular opinion, you do not need... -A Sunday -Music -Lights -Sound equipment -Ample seating -Live streaming -Money -A bulletin -Christianese -A pastor All you need is... -2 or more people -God The activity that we commonly label as "church" and attach all kinds of baggage to is simply 2 or more Christ-followers meeting together with God to worship the Him, seek His face, know Him more, and encourage each other. Read Acts if you don't believe me. We could "have church" hanging off a cliff. Upside down. With our heads in the ocean. Seriously. [Sidenote: you could pray that God would remove my cynicism. Sorry. But on the bright side, isn't it awesome that you need literally no external stuff to meet with God?!??]
